Are people in Simpsonville older or younger than people in New London?
- The Median Age in Simpsonville is 3.9 years older than in New London.

Are housing costs cheaper in Simpsonville or New London?
- Simpsonville housing costs are 42.1% more expensive than New London hous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Simpsonville or New London?
- The average commute for residents of Simpsonville is 5.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of New London.
